UV Cured Coatings Market Analysis
The global UV curved coatings market has evolved rapidly due to rising demand from automotive, furniture, electronics, and architectural industries. Leading multinational companies such as Allnex, Covestro, BASF, and DSM have developed advanced urethane and epoxy acrylate formulations capable of curing efficiently on complex curved surfaces, including automotive dashboards, convex furniture panels, and consumer electronics housings. Initially, UV coatings were primarily applied to flat surfaces, but innovations in rheology modifiers, flexible oligomers, and leveling agents have enabled consistent coating on concave, convex, and irregular geometries without sagging or edge buildup. Spray coating remains the dominant application method worldwide, while electrostatic and curtain coating techniques are increasingly deployed in high-precision production lines for automotive interiors in Germany, Italy, China, and Mexico, and for furniture manufacturing in the United States, Australia, and Argentina. LED UV curing systems from IST Metz, Phoseon Technology, and Heraeus Noblelight have enhanced energy efficiency, reduced shadowing, and improved process speed across heat-sensitive plastics, metals, and engineered wood substrates. Adhesion challenges on diverse materials, from polycarbonate and ABS plastics to metals and composites, are addressed by specialized primers and photoinitiators supplied by Covestro, Allnex, and BASF. Environmental and regulatory pressures from agencies such as the European Chemicals Agency (ECHA), the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ency, and China’s Ministry of Ecology and Environment have accelerated adoption of low-VOC, solvent-free, and waterborne chemistries. Automation and robotics integration by Nordson, Dürr, and local integrators enable precise application, repeatable curing, and consistent film thickness on curved surfaces.
Collaborative R&D with technical institutes such as Politecnico di Milano, Tsinghua University, CSIRO, and Tecnológico de Monterrey has fostered hybrid UV systems, dual-cure technologies, and advanced photoinitiator formulations that maintain gloss, flexibility, chemical resistance, and surface hardness on complex geometries. Market Dynamic
• Automotive Interior Demand: The rising production of automotive interiors with complex geometries globally drives UV curved coatings adoption. Companies like BMW in Germany, SAIC Motor in China, and Ford in the U.S. increasingly use UV coatings for dashboards, center consoles, and trims due to their fast curing, high gloss, and chemical resistance. LED UV curing systems from IST Metz and Phoseon allow precise application on concave and convex surfaces, making these coatings ideal for intricate automotive designs while improving energy efficiency.
• Furniture & Decorative Growth: The expansion of furniture and interior décor industries in the U.S., Mexico, China, and Europe fuels UV curved coatings demand. Manufacturers like PPG Industries, Allnex, and Sherwin-Williams supply flexible urethane acrylates and oligomers that ensure smooth finishes on convex cabinet doors, MDF panels, and decorative laminates. Advanced photoinitiators and flow additives enhance adhesion and leveling, making UV coatings essential for aesthetic and durable furniture production, aligning with consumer preferences for high-gloss, scratch-resistant surfaces. Market Challenges
• High Equipment Cost: Initial investment in LED UV curing systems, robotic spray stations, and automated coating lines is a barrier, particularly for SMEs. Systems from IST Metz, Nordson, and Dürr require significant capital, limiting adoption in regions like Latin America and the Middle East where smaller manufacturers dominate. Maintenance and energy management add operational costs, making it challenging for companies to scale UV curved coatings for complex industrial and decorative applications.
• Substrate Adhesion Issues: Achieving uniform adhesion on irregular or curved surfaces remains challenging. Concave plastics, metals, and engineered wood can experience sagging or incomplete curing, especially without proper primers or photoinitiator systems. Companies like Covestro and BASF continuously develop adhesion promoters, yet inconsistent surface preparation or opacity of substrates can still lead to defects, affecting production efficiency and finish quality globally. Market Trends
• LED UV Curing: LED UV systems are replacing traditional mercury lamps due to higher energy efficiency, faster curing, and reduced heat damage. Global manufacturers such as IST Metz, Phoseon Technology, and Heraeus Noblelight implement LED curing for automotive interiors, electronics housings, and decorative panels, enabling precise coating on curved substrates while minimizing environmental impact and operational costs.
• Automation Integration: Robotics and automated spray systems are increasingly used in automotive, furniture, and electronics production. Companies like Nordson, Dürr, and PPG Industries provide integrated solutions for precise application, consistent film thickness, and repeatable curing on concave and convex surfaces. This trend reduces manual errors, improves throughput, and ensures high-quality coatings for complex geometries across global manufacturing hubs.

Oligomers are leading by composition in the global UV curved coatings market because they provide the essential backbone that determines the mechanical strength, flexibility, and curing efficiency of coatings applied on complex surfaces.
Oligomers are critical in UV curable coatings as they form the fundamental molecular framework that directly impacts performance characteristics such as hardness, adhesion, and resistance to cracking, especially on curved and non-planar surfaces. Companies like Arkema and Allnex have focused on developing urethane acrylate and epoxy acrylate oligomers that allow coatings to withstand mechanical stress while maintaining high gloss, which is particularly important in automotive interiors, decorative furniture, and electronic housings. The molecular weight and chemical structure of oligomers can be tuned to provide varying degrees of flexibility and crosslink density, enabling converters to produce coatings that flow evenly over convex and concave geometries without sagging or pooling. Unlike monomers or additives, oligomers largely determine the cured film’s durability and scratch resistance, which is why industrial users prioritize them when selecting materials for high-performance applications. The advancements in oligomer chemistry have also enabled faster curing under LED UV lamps, reducing energy consumption and minimizing thermal stress on heat-sensitive substrates such as polymers and composites used in electronics and packaging. Moreover, oligomers contribute to compatibility with photoinitiators and other additives, allowing formulators to achieve precise control over curing depth, surface finish, and chemical resistance. The flexibility in formulation offered by oligomers allows manufacturers to meet both aesthetic requirements, such as gloss and clarity on curved displays, and functional requirements, such as chemical resistance in packaging or abrasion resistance in furniture. Their ability to balance rigidity and elasticity makes oligomers indispensable in UV coatings where uniformity, durability, and performance across complex shapes are critical. As research in high-performance urethane acrylates and hybrid oligomer systems continues, their role in shaping modern UV curved coatings remains unmatched, solidifying their position as the dominant component by composition.
Wood coatings are leading by type in the global UV curved coatings market because they provide unmatched surface protection and aesthetic enhancement for furniture, decorative panels, and architectural wood applications that often involve complex curved geometries.
Wood has historically been a primary substrate for UV curved coatings due to its widespread use in furniture, cabinetry, flooring, and interior architectural elements that require precise finishing and surface durability. Companies like PPG Industries and Sherwin-Williams have developed specialized UV-curable wood coating systems, including polyurethane acrylate formulations, which offer rapid curing, excellent adhesion, and high gloss retention on curved and concave surfaces. The demand for premium aesthetics in furniture, especially in markets where design and appearance directly influence product value, has driven significant adoption of UV coatings on wood, as these coatings provide a smooth, uniform finish that enhances natural wood grains while resisting scratches and stains. Curved wooden furniture, decorative moldings, and stair components present unique challenges in coating application, and UV systems allow precise control over film thickness, preventing sagging or pooling in concave or convex surfaces. Moreover, advancements in LED UV curing technology have enabled manufacturers to coat large volumes of wood with faster production cycles while maintaining consistent surface quality. Environmental considerations have also favored UV-curable wood coatings since they are low in volatile organic compounds compared to conventional solvent-based finishes, aligning with regulations and consumer demand for eco-friendly furniture products. Technical innovations by formulators, including the addition of flow modifiers and adhesion enhancers, have further improved the performance of UV coatings on curved wooden surfaces, ensuring long-lasting durability and resistance to moisture and wear. The combination of functional protection, aesthetic enhancement, and compatibility with modern manufacturing practices ensures that wood remains the leading substrate for UV curved coatings, especially in applications where appearance, surface uniformity, and resilience are critical factors.
Industrial coatings are leading by end-use industry in the global UV curved coatings market because they deliver robust performance and long-term durability required for complex machinery, automotive components, and protective equipment exposed to harsh operational conditions.
Industrial applications demand coatings that can withstand mechanical abrasion, chemical exposure, thermal cycling, and repeated handling while maintaining aesthetic quality, making UV curable coatings a preferred choice for curved surfaces in this sector. Leading suppliers such as BASF, AkzoNobel, and Axalta have formulated high-performance urethane acrylates and hybrid coatings tailored for use on curved metal, polymer, and composite components in automotive, electronics, and heavy equipment manufacturing. The precision offered by UV systems allows for uniform coverage on non-planar geometries, ensuring that critical surfaces such as instrument panels, protective housings, and control equipment are evenly coated without defects like pooling or sagging. Industrial coatings also benefit from rapid curing capabilities that reduce production cycle times and minimize downtime, which is particularly valuable for high-volume manufacturing environments. Moreover, these coatings offer superior resistance to abrasion, corrosion, chemical agents, and UV exposure, which extends the service life of machinery, automotive interiors, and industrial infrastructure. Companies such as Sherwin-Williams and HMG Paints have partnered with equipment manufacturers to implement conveyor and rotational UV curing systems capable of handling complex shapes, further supporting consistent quality in industrial applications. The combination of durability, precise application, and rapid curing makes industrial coatings a critical component for manufacturers seeking to improve product longevity and performance while maintaining efficiency. The ability to meet stringent operational and safety standards across multiple sectors ensures that industrial applications continue to drive demand for UV curved coatings globally.
UV Cured Coatings Market Regional Insights
Asia-Pacific is leading the global UV curved coatings market because the region has a high concentration of manufacturing hubs, extensive OEM networks, and widespread adoption of advanced UV curing technologies for both industrial and consumer applications.
Asia-Pacific dominates the global UV curved coatings landscape due to its strategic combination of large-scale manufacturing clusters, extensive electronics, automotive, furniture, and packaging industries, and rapid adoption of technological innovations such as LED UV curing systems. Countries like China, Japan, South Korea, and India host major OEMs and converters that require efficient coating solutions for complex curved surfaces, including automotive interiors, consumer electronics housings, curved furniture panels, and high-end packaging, creating significant demand for high-performance UV coatings. Suppliers such as Allnex, Arkema, and BASF have established extensive production and distribution networks across the region to provide oligomer and photoinitiator systems tailored for curved substrates, while equipment manufacturers offer LED-based UV curing lines that reduce energy consumption and minimize thermal stress on sensitive materials. The region’s focus on industrial modernization and lean manufacturing has accelerated adoption of UV coatings due to their fast curing times and reduced material wastage, which aligns with high-throughput production requirements. Rapid urbanization and rising consumer demand for premium finishes in furniture, electronics, and packaging have further reinforced the need for coatings that offer high gloss, chemical resistance, and durability on curved surfaces. Local technical centers and research institutions collaborate with international suppliers to optimize formulations for regional substrates such as engineered wood, plastics, and composites, improving performance consistency and process efficiency. The combination of robust industrial infrastructure, high production volumes, technological expertise, and strong OEM networks positions Asia-Pacific as the leading region, driving innovation, adoption, and ongoing growth in the global UV curved coatings market.
